Remodeling costs vary based on your specific goals. Choosing high-end materials like natural stone, custom cabinetry, or designer hardware will increase the total. Labor costs fluctuate depending on whether you are simply updating fixtures or doing a full layout overhaul that requires moving plumbing and electrical lines. Keeping your existing footprint is the most effective way to save, while expanding the space or adding luxury features like steam showers pushes the budget higher. A jacuzzi bath remodel cost is influenced by the model of the jetted tub, the space required for installation, and any necessary electrical upgrades for the pump. For Wichita homes, ceramic and porcelain tiles are excellent choices for bathrooms due to their durability and water resistance. Consider non-slip finishes for floors, especially in showers. For shower areas, durable and water-resistant tiles like porcelain, ceramic, or natural stone are excellent choices. Consider textured tiles for improved slip resistance. A modern bathroom vanity typically features clean lines, minimalist hardware, and finishes like high-gloss lacquer or natural wood. Floating vanities are also popular for a contemporary look.
